On degree based topological indices of bridge graphs
Abdul Jalil M. Khalaf, Muhammad Farhan Hanif, Muhammad Kamran Siddiqui, Mohammad Reza Farahani
Abstract
In 2009, T. Mansour, M. Schork, introduce the concept of bridge graphs. A bridge graph B(G1, G2, … , Gm ) = B(G1, G2, … , Gm; v1, v2, … , vm) of with respect to the vertices is the graph obtained from the graphs G1; G2; … ; Gm by connecting the vertices vi and vi+1 by an edge for all I = 1; 2; … ; m-1. In this paper, we determine hyper-Zagreb index, first multiple Zagreb index, second multiple Zagreb index, Zagreb polynomials and M-polynomial for nano structures of bridge graphs.
